Result : NAMIBIA 46 v 13 KENYA

Follow @RedefinedRugby  Namibia  46 : 13 Kenya  Namibia recorded an emphatic 46-13 win over Kenya in a Windhoek Draught Africa Cup match at the Hage Geingob Stadium in Windhoek on Saturday. Namibia led 25-6 at the break. Their six-try win over the East African side came just over a year after Namibia lost to Kenya…

ZIMBABWE EDGE KENYA IN HARARE

Follow @RedefinedRugby Zimbabwe overcame a committed Kenyan side 28-20 in a thrilling encounter at Prince Edward School’s Jubilee Field yesterday. The Sables scored three tries through Sanele Sibanda, Rian O’Neill and Tafadzwa Chitokwindo while flyhalf Tichafara Makwanya was impressive from the kicking tee as he chipped in with 15 points from two conversions and three…

KENYA SWEEP 2014 ELGON CUP

Follow @RedefinedRugby Kenya have swept the Elgon Cup by claiming victory in all three categories of the Elgon Cup. Kenya’s U-19s started the sweep by defeating their Ugandan counterparts 27-12 on the day to claim a 37-27 aggregate win, having lost the first leg 10-15 in Kampala last weekend.
